Explore The Extensive Web Providers Manual For A Thorough Introduction To Interaction Protocols-Your Secret To Opening The World Of Web Services
Explore The Extensive Web Providers Manual For A Thorough Introduction To Interaction Protocols-Your Secret To Opening The World Of Web Services
Blog Article
Created By-Cotton Brewer
Discover the utmost Web Providers Handbook for all your needs. Explore communication procedures, core principles of SOAP and remainder, and finest practices for smooth implementation. Discover the secrets to mastering internet services, from comprehending the essentials to applying scalable architecture. modern website design of making safe systems and optimizing for future growth. Unlock the power of web services within your reaches.
Introduction of Web Solutions
If you've ever wondered what internet services are and exactly how they function, this overview is the ideal location to begin. Internet solutions are a means for various applications to connect with each other over the internet. They enable smooth combination of systems, making it less complicated to share data and capabilities.
Among the essential aspects of internet services is their use of basic methods like HTTP and XML to promote interaction. This standardization makes certain that different systems can comprehend and engage with each other successfully. Internet solutions can be categorized right into two major types: SOAP (Simple Things Gain Access To Method) and REST (Representational State Transfer).
SOAP is a protocol that makes use of XML for message exchange, while REST depends on basic HTTP methods like GET, UPLOAD, PUT, and DELETE. Both have their toughness and are used in numerous scenarios based on needs.
Secret Concepts and Technologies
Discovering the foundational principles and modern technologies of internet services is essential for understanding their functionality and application in modern-day systems. When delving right into the essential principles and technologies of internet solutions, you unlock to a globe of interconnected opportunities. Right here are some essential elements to grasp:
- ** SOAP (Simple Object Access Protocol) **: This procedure defines the framework of messages exchanged between internet services.
- ** WSDL (Web Services Description Language) **: WSDL is made use of to define the functionalities supplied by a web solution.
- ** REST (Representational State Transfer) **: An architectural style that utilizes basic HTTP approaches for interaction between customers and web servers.
- ** XML (Extensible Markup Language) **: XML plays a vital role in information exchange in between internet services as a result of its flexibility and readability.
Comprehending these core ideas and innovations will certainly lay a solid foundation for your trip right into the realm of internet solutions.
Best Practices for Implementation
To make certain successful execution of web solutions, focus on adherence to finest practices. Begin by extensively documenting your internet solution APIs, including clear descriptions of endpoints, criteria, and anticipated responses. Constant calling conventions and versioning of APIs are vital for maintainability. When making your internet services, comply with the principles of REST to produce a scalable and flexible style. Apply correct authentication and permission devices to protect your services, such as OAuth or API keys.
Evaluating is crucial in making sure the integrity of your web services. Establish thorough test cases that cover various circumstances, consisting of positive and adverse screening. Continuous combination and automated screening can assist capture problems early in the development process. Monitor your internet services in real-time to determine efficiency bottlenecks and potential failings. Logging and mistake handling are crucial for diagnosing concerns and repairing issues effectively.
Finally, think about the scalability of your internet services by designing for future development. https://best-seo-plugins-for-word05173.blog-mall.com/30422641/enhance-your-ppc-marketing-efforts-by-executing-reliable-keyword-research-study-tactics-that-will-certainly-change-your-campaigns-find-out-more-today caching devices and lots harmonizing to deal with increased website traffic. healthcare website design and optimize your code for effectiveness. By adhering to these finest practices, you can streamline the application of internet services and guarantee their success.
Verdict
Congratulations! You have actually just opened the secret to mastering web solutions. By understanding the vital concepts and modern technologies, and implementing finest methods, you're well on your means to becoming an internet solutions expert.
Keep exploring and explore what you've learned to proceed broadening your expertise and skills in this interesting field.
The globe of web solutions is now within your reaches, all set for you to discover and dominate. Take web design business in the journey!